diff --git a/qemu_mode/README.md b/qemu_mode/README.md index bc4c1d2c..a14cbe64 100644 --- a/qemu_mode/README.md +++ b/qemu_mode/README.md @@ -99,6 +99,13 @@ Just set AFL_QEMU_INST_RANGES=A,B,C... The format of the items in the list is either a range of addresses like 0x123-0x321 or a module name like module.so (that is matched in the mapped object filename). +Alternatively you can tell QEMU to ignore part of an address space for instrumentation. + +Just set AFL_QEMU_EXCLUDE_RANGES=A,B,C... + +The format of the items on the list is the same as for AFL_QEMU_INST_RANGES, and excluding ranges +takes priority over any included ranges or AFL_INST_LIBS. + ## 7) CompareCoverage CompareCoverage is a sub-instrumentation with effects similar to laf-intel. |
